Cold Tuna Salad Recipe

The ingredients needed to make Cold Tuna Salad:
- Get 1 1/2 cup Real mayonnaise
- Get 3 can tuna (in oil)
- Make ready 6 hard boiled eggs
- Make ready 6 stalks celery chopped fine
- Make ready 1 tsp onion salt
- Take 1 tbsp onion powder
- Prepare 2 small or one large box pasta rings
- Get 1 box frozen baby or regular size peas
Instructions to make Cold Tuna Salad:
- Boil pasta rings; drain and rinse well with cold water until cool to the touch. You can add peas to the pasta at the very end and boil for about 30 seconds and then drain and rinse with the pasta to save a step.
- Hard boil eggs until done; drain then run cold water over them till they feel cool (or add ice to cold water in pan).
- In large bowl combine mayo, tuna, onion salt/powder and gently stir together. Taste mixture; it should taste oniony and a little bit too salty. If not add small amounts of the onion salt until it does. You will be adding the rings and eggs so don’t worry about it being too salty.
- Add chopped celery and mix together. Add half of the rings and gently fold wet mixture and celery into rings. When they are combined add rest of rings and gently mix in.
- Cut hard boiled eggs into small pieces and carefully fold into pasta mixture. Taste and add mayo and/or more seasoning.
- Refrigerate until cold. It actually gets tastier the longer it cools. You can use finely chopped onions but I prefer the seasonings. My mom used to add thinly sliced radishes and garnish with sliced boiled eggs and paprika sprinkled on top.
